Emergency Plumber vs. General Trade: What Is the Difference?

A general plumbing contractor is excellent for planned work — fitting a new bathroom, replacing a boiler, or moving a radiator. They book appointments in advance and work regular hours.

An emergency plumber does something different: they respond to faults that cannot safely wait. That includes:

  • Burst or leaking pipes (especially behind walls or under floors)
  • Loss of water pressure across the whole property
  • Overflowing or blocked toilets with no alternative available
  • Hot water failure in a home with young children or elderly residents
  • Visible water ingress through ceilings or walls
  • Commercial premises where a fault is affecting trading

Before the Plumber Arrives: Four Things to Do Right Now

If you have an active leak or burst pipe, do these steps immediately:

  1. Turn off the stopcock. In most Teddington properties it is under the kitchen sink or in the downstairs cloakroom. Turning it clockwise stops the mains supply.
  2. Turn off the boiler if water is near any electrics or the boiler itself.
  3. Switch off the electricity at the consumer unit if water is dripping near light fittings, sockets, or any wiring.
  4. Photograph everything — the source of the leak, any damage to ceilings, floors, or walls, and the affected area before you move anything.

These steps limit damage and give you a clear record of what happened.
